Manufacturers of automobiles provide factory service manuals, which are meant for use by the service departments of their dealers. As they are meant for professional technicians, a certain level of expertise and understanding is thus anticipated. Conversely, aftermarket repair guides from companies like Chilton and Haynes are intended for do-it-yourselfers.

While there are always exceptions to the norm, the vast majority of the service manuals on this list, including the GM manuals, were created with professional mechanics in mind. These factory repair manuals cover everything from the suspension system and brakes to engines and gearboxes, and they are filled with clear, helpful graphics and thorough specifications.

It’s also important to keep in mind that sometimes a manufacturer handbook may specify a certain tool. When it occurs, the component number from the manufacturer will be referred to.

A factory manual, also known as a manufacturer’s service handbook, factory repair manual, or O.E.M. (Original Equipment Manufacturer) shop manual, might be the only accessible resource in some situations since not all makes and models are covered by the aftermarket.

Why It’s Important to Refer to the Correct Repair Information

With hundreds of computers and miles of wire inside, modern cars are very complex. Furthermore, a repair strategy that suits one automobile may not suit another due to the differences between all makes and models.

Because of this, it’s more important than ever to refer to a repair database or manual before doing any auto repairs. You run the danger of changing needless components and losing time and money if you don’t do your study beforehand.

Prevent Wasting Money and Time

My acquaintance is often trying to fix autos without looking up the necessary repair manuals. He often replaces components as a result of this tendency, which, as was already said, wastes money and time.

He recently phoned me, for instance, to report that the check engine light on a Honda was on. The powertrain control module (PCM), the car’s main computer, has code P0139, or “Heated Oxygen Sensor (Bank 1, Sensor 1) Slow Response,” saved in its memory.

My buddy had rebuilt the catalytic converter and oxygen sensors in an effort to clear the code, but it remained.

We found the issue over the phone in a matter of minutes using a repair database called Identifix. I discovered a technical service bulletin (TSB) during my investigation that recommended reprogramming the PCM to fix the problem. After that, the vehicle was taken to the dealer, where the PCM was updated and the issue resolved.

There are several tales that are comparable to the one that was just cited. I’m not sure how many times we’ve called auto diagnoses using wiring diagrams and TSB searches.

trying to fix autos

Knowledge is essential for resolving challenging issues. And there’s a strong possibility you’ll wind up chasing your tail when it comes to mending automobiles if you don’t have that knowledge (which may be found in a repair database or service handbook).

Additionally, you run the risk of harming yourself or your car.

Avoid Personal Injury

Those who neglected to examine the required repair information before to working on their automobile have had some terrifying things happen (or almost happen), in my experience.

One client I worked with as a mechanic brought his car in after trying to repair the struts. He didn’t know what he was doing, so he didn’t check the repair manual before removing the strut nut and compressing the coil spring. The coil spring therefore caused serious damage as it passed through the fender well and into the car’s bonnet.

I saw someone manipulating high-voltage wires on a Toyota Prius a little while ago. This person was not wearing any personal protective equipment and had not unplugged the hybrid battery service plug. That might result in fatalities or severe injuries.

It is evident that he did not research the process in a repair database before taking action.

Repairing automobiles may be risky, even for experienced mechanics. You greatly increase your risk of injury if you don’t know what to do because you haven’t studied the repair instructions and safety advice.

Things Every Car Owner Should Know

A car is a complex machine, and caring for it effectively requires a little bit of study and research. This needn’t imply a great deal of effort, however – just a few minutes spent committing a few critical details to memory can make an enormous difference.

Knowing what car you’re driving

You should know not only the make and model of your vehicle, but the year it was manufactured. Learning the registration number by heart can be tricky – but if you recite it every morning for a week, you can be fairly sure you’ll never forget it.

It’s also worth learning your insurance details. You never know when you’ll be called on to recall them. You might write key details down and stow them in the glove compartment. You’ll want to know the extent and type of your coverage. Contract hire gap insurance provides a very different level of cover in certain situations, for example.

How to check tyre pressure

If you can’t inflate your tyres, then you’ll ultimately suffer from poor fuel economy, and an inferior driving experience. You can either inflate your tyres at your local petrol station, or do it at home. Learn what your tyre pressure should be, and inflate often enough that you don’t forget. Bear in mind that different pressures are appropriate, depending on how laden the vehicle is.

Dashboard lights

A whole range of lights might pop up on your dashboard. The good news is that these lights are often self-explanatory, and universal; once you’ve learned them in one vehicle, you’ll know what’s going to happen in another. If the check engine light comes on, it’s time to visit a mechanic and get the engine checked.

Fuelling the car

You won’t be able to drive a car for very long if you don’t know how to fill it up. It’s worth figuring this out before you arrive at the filling station. Make sure you know where the petrol cap release is, if you have one inside the car. You should also know how to change coolant, oil and wiper fluid.

If you’re driving a hybrid or battery-electric vehicle, you’ll also need to know how you’re going to charge it. It’s also worth researching the charging options near you. If you’re planning on visiting a different part of the country, you’ll also need to know where the charging stations are – assuming that those charging stations aren’t out of action.

Getting a feel for the car

Often, the early warning signs of a problem with the vehicle can be subtle. For this reason, it’s critical that you understand what the car is supposed to feel like when everything is working properly. Pay attention to the steering and the brakes. The more experience you have in the vehicle, the more attuned you’ll become to its behaviour!

Introduction to Engine Diagnostics

As a car owner, it’s important to understand the significance of engine diagnostics and how they can help maintain the health of your vehicle. An engine diagnostic is a comprehensive service that involves using advanced technology to assess the performance and condition of your engine.

By analysing the data obtained through the diagnostic process, mechanics can identify any underlying issues or potential problems that may be affecting the performance of your vehicle. This guide aims to provide you with a comprehensive understanding of engine diagnostics, why it is important, and how it can help you troubleshoot engine issues effectively.

What is an engine diagnostic service?

An engine diagnostic service involves the use of specialised tools and equipment to connect to your vehicle’s onboard computer system. This allows mechanics to retrieve valuable information about your engine’s performance, including error codes, sensor readings, and other critical data. This service is typically performed by trained professionals who have access to the necessary diagnostic tools and software.

Why are engine diagnostics important?

Engine diagnostics play a crucial role in identifying potential problems with your vehicle’s engine. By detecting issues early on, you can save yourself from costly repairs down the line. Engine diagnostics also help improve the overall performance and fuel efficiency of your vehicle. By addressing any underlying problems promptly, you can ensure that your engine operates optimally, reducing the risk of breakdowns and extending the lifespan of your vehicle.

Signs that Your Vehicle May Need an Engine Diagnostic

There are several signs that indicate your vehicle may require an engine diagnostic. If you notice any of the following symptoms, it is advisable to have your engine checked by a professional:

  1. Check Engine Light: If the check engine light on your dashboard is illuminated, it is a clear indication that there is an issue with your engine.
  2. Poor Performance: If your vehicle is experiencing a decrease in power, acceleration, or overall performance, it may be due to an underlying engine problem.
  3. Strange Noises: Unusual noises such as knocking, rattling, or squealing could be a sign of engine trouble.
  4. Increased Fuel Consumption: If you notice that your vehicle is consuming more fuel than usual, it could be indicative of an engine issue.
  5. Smell of Burning: A strong smell of burning oil or rubber could signify a serious engine problem that requires immediate attention.

How does an engine diagnostic work?

During an engine diagnostic, a mechanic will connect a diagnostic tool to your vehicle’s onboard computer system, which is commonly known as the OBD-II (On-Board Diagnostics) system. This tool retrieves valuable information such as error codes, sensor readings, and other data that can help identify any issues with your engine. The mechanic will then interpret this data to diagnose the problem accurately.

Common Engine Issues Identified Through Diagnostics

Engine diagnostics can help identify a wide range of engine issues. Some common problems that can be identified through diagnostics include:

  1. Malfunctioning Oxygen Sensor: A faulty oxygen sensor can lead to decreased fuel efficiency and increased emissions.
  2. Ignition System Problems: Issues with the ignition system, such as a malfunctioning spark plug or ignition coil, can cause misfires and reduced engine performance.
  3. Fuel System Issues: Problems with the fuel injectors, fuel pump, or fuel filter can lead to poor fuel efficiency and engine misfires.
  4. Emission Control System Malfunctions: Engine diagnostics can help pinpoint problems with the emission control system, ensuring compliance with environmental regulations.

Troubleshooting Engine Problems with Diagnostic Tools

Once an issue has been identified through engine diagnostics, mechanics can use specialised diagnostic tools to troubleshoot and fix the problem. These tools allow them to access specific components of the engine and perform tests to determine the root cause of the issue. By using these tools, mechanics can efficiently diagnose and repair engine problems, saving you time and money.
